1. MODALS
What is the form for the: Present
simple/continuous
Past
S + modal + verb (base form)
S + modal + be + verb(ing)
S + modal + have + past participle
S + must + have + been + verb(ing)
2. MUST
You are sweating! You must be hot!
MAY
He is wearing a suit. He may work at a bank.
COULD
They look alike. They could be siblings.
MIGHT
She looks sad. She might be bored.
CAN’T
He’s kissing her! She can’t be his sister!
